Bill Brovold
Bill Brovold is an educator, visual artist, and composer/musician. He has performed with Rhys Chatham, Arthur Russell, and Glenn Branca; and led the New York band Strange Farm (featuring Billy Ficca of Television and Ernie Brooks of the Modern Lovers) and the six-to-thirteen-member Detroit post rock band Larval, which features his twangy guitar alongside a wall-of-sound onslaught of horns and strings. He has released music on John Zorn’s Avant and Tzadik imprints and the Cuneiform, Knitting Factory, and RareNoise labels (a duet with Jamie Saft for the latter). His most recent releases, for the Public Eyesore and Team Love labels, see him paring down his sound for more intimate surroundings—closer to what he might do with a few friends in someone’s living room.
Duo Denum
Duo Denum is Al Margolis and Tom Law.
Al Margolis is a composer/performer, improvisor, and painter. Since 1984, often under his project name If, Bwana, he has worked in the field of non-commercial, non-popular music and sound.
Tom Law is a composer/improviser from Saugerties NY who performs laptop-based electroacoustic music with viola da gamba. He is also a member of Nautilus Renaissance Viols and a former member of the New York Continuo Collective.
